Spiderhouse (probably one of Austin's most representative coffee shop-bar-patios) is hosting a full evening of music and fashion this Saturday, dubbed Fashion Freakout. Because Austin style is significantly influenced by its vintage stores (New Bohemia, Buffalo Exchange, and Prototype Vintage Design will all be featured), the show aims to display local fashion's marriage to music and to showcase some new-old designs from recycled duds. Prototype Vintage Design will also be decorating the show while Pink Hair Salon takes care of hair and make-up.

DJs Tono-Loco, Brian Tweedy (Tighten Up), and Jason McNeely (Nite Moves) get the night spinning with rock and roll sets, and at 10pm, the Riverboat Gamblers' Mike Weibe will MC the action on the catwalk. Rounding out the night with energetic sets are Shapes Have Fangs and Toko Ri Get High.
